{"status": "success", "data": {"description_md": "Real numbers $x$ and $y$ satisfy the equation $x^2 + y^2 = 10x - 6y - 34$. What is $x + y$?\n\n$\\textbf{(A)}\\ 1 \\qquad \\textbf{(B)}\\ 2 \\qquad \\textbf{(C)}\\ 3 \\qquad \\textbf{(D)}\\ 6 \\qquad \\textbf{(E)}\\ 8$\n___\nFull credit goes to [MAA](https://maa.org/) for authoring these problems.
